TOON STARS CAN'T KEEP TRIPPING UP

NEWCASTLE defender Kieran Trippier has told his teammates they must take onboard the stinging criticism that came their way after this latest loss.

Trippier will leave the club next month, but was the only player to front up for media duties after another dire defeat for the Magpies and another late goal conceded. It does not get any easier for Newcastle, as they head to Arsenal next weekend - a venue where they have not won in the Premier League since 2010.

However, Trippier was keen to address their problems after Bournemouth left-back Adrien Truffert put a dent in the Toon's lingering hopes of European qualification with his late winner.

The reality is Newcastle are looking over their shoulder after William Osula cancelling out Marcus Tavernier's opener counted for nothing at St James' Park, prompting boos from home fans.

Trippier said: "I am not going to stand here and criticise my teammates, but it is us as players that need to take responsibility.
